> ThreadPoolExecutors should terminate faster

> I've observed that the termination of
> {{org.apache.mina.filter.executor.PriorityThreadPoolExecutor}} takes another
> 30 seconds after the last task was executed. More specifically, it takes 30
> seconds "to long" before
> {{org.apache.mina.filter.executor.PriorityThreadPoolExecutor#awaitTermination}}
> returns {{true}}.
> It is likely that this issue also applies to
> {{org.apache.mina.filter.executor.OrderedThreadPoolExecutor}}, and maybe
> {{org.apache.mina.filter.executor.UnorderedThreadPoolExecutor}}, as a lot of
> code is shared between these implementations. I did not explicitly verify
> these implementations though.
